[Mono-docs-list] auto-add nodes to monodoc.xml

Martin Willemoes Hansen mwh@sysrq.dk
03 Jul 2003 15:34:15 +0200

On Thu, 2003-07-03 at 12:14, Gonzalo Paniagua Javier wrote:
> El jue, 03-07-2003 a las 02:35, John Luke escribi=F3:
> > Hello,
> >=20
> > I was thinking it might be a good idea to make it easier for external
> > projects to add themselves to monodoc.xml
> >=20
> > I wanted to be able to do something like:
> > monodoc --add-node GtkMozEmbed
> >=20
> > to automatically add a line like:
> > <node label=3D"GtkMozEmbed Libraries" name=3D"classlib-gtkmozembed" />
> >=20
> > So this is what the attached patch and file do.  (Hopefully) you will b=
> > able to add a line to the install of your docs Makefile to have it adde=
> > automatically. As an added bonus we could remove the extra libs from
> > monodoc.xml so they are not displayed until installed.
> Nice!
> It would also be great, now that you're on the case, to have a
> --remove-node for uninstalling purposes.

Maybe this kind of setting could be put into the GConf database, you
wont have to restart MonoDoc for the stuff to be displayed.
Also I use some wird system of loging wich files I install and when I
uninstall a program it uninstalls the files loged .. this configuration
file will be changed and loged and removed when I remove the package in
the system I use. It wont be with the gconf thingy. Anyways thats my two
cents. Anyways I can configure my system to not care about that conf
file hehe.

Martin Willemoes Hansen

E-Mail	mwh@sysrq.dk	Website	mwh.sysrq.dk
IRC     MWH, freenode.net=09
--------------------------------------------------------              =20